We are looking for a highly qualified candidate to coordinate and collaborate with the other protection team.   Who are we DRC has been operating in the Middle East and North Africa for over a decade , running a combination of livelihood , protection ,advocacy and relief projects .DRC has six project offices throughout Iraq, Syria , Tunisia/Libya , Turkey , and both a country and regional office in Jordan . Since May 2011, DRC has been actively involved in the Lebanon emergency response to the Syrian crisis with presence in the North, East (Bekaa valley) and South of Lebanon. . The DRC response is designed around 4 majors sectors: Food /NFI distribution,Protection , Shelter and livelihood support . Applications close July 07-14. The interviews are expected to take place the week after.   _________________________________________________________________________________ About DRC The Danish Refugee Council (DRC) is a private, independent, humanitarian organization working on all aspects of the refugee cause in more than thirty countries throughout the world. The aim of DRC is to protect refugees and internally displaced persons (IDPs) against persecution and to promote durable solutions to the problems of forced migration on the basis of humanitarian principles and human rights. DRC works in accordance with the UN Conventions on Refugees and the Code of Conduct for the Red Cross/ Red Crescent and NGOs in Disaster Relief.
